LG CNS is strengthening its social contribution program, ‘AI Genius’.


On the 14th, LG CNS visited Ganggu Middle School located in Yeongdeok, Gyeongbuk, to conduct the AI Genius program. About 60 students from Ganggu Middle School and Byeonggok Middle School participated in the program together. During the 6-hour regular class, students learned about new DX (digital transformation) technologies such as ▲AI logistics robots ▲AI chatbots ▲MyData, and applied this knowledge to create their own services.


LG CNS is continuously expanding AI Genius to rural areas, remote islands, and special schools. In March, the program was held at Gyeonghui School in Gyeongju, Gyeongbuk, and in May, at Yesan Kkumbit School in Yesan County, Chungnam, both special schools. The AI Genius classes at special schools consist of ▲AI overview education in metaverse virtual spaces ▲art activities using AI (drawing, music) ▲AI autonomous vehicle creation, among others.


LG CNS started AI Genius in 2017 to nurture more future DX talents. From the following year, the program expanded beyond Seoul to middle schools in rural and remote areas such as ▲Gimje, Jeonbuk ▲Eumseong, Chungbuk ▲Wando, Jeonnam ▲Yeongcheon, Gyeongbuk ▲Yeongwol, Gangwon. Since 2021, LG CNS has been visiting special schools to allow disabled youth to experience AI. To date, LG CNS has provided IT education to about 230 schools and over 18,000 students.


LG CNS also operates the ‘AI Genius Academy.’ The AI Genius Academy is designed for high school students and is an advanced program of AI Genius. It offers one year of education in AI, big data, coding, and career planning. Any high school student interested in AI nationwide can apply and participate as a school unit.


Recently, as part of the AI Genius Academy, LG CNS held ‘AI Day.’ About 80 students were invited to LG CNS’s Magok headquarters from among approximately 480 students participating in the AI Genius Academy. They received offline education on AI-based image data learning and classification.


Recognizing these DX capability-based social contribution activities, LG CNS received the Prime Minister’s Commendation at the ‘2023 Information Culture Development Merit Government Awards’ on the 15th. The Ministry of Science and ICT selected and awarded individuals and organizations that contributed to nurturing future software talents and bridging regional digital information gaps in celebration of the 36th Information Culture Month.
